Housing and Development Properties (HDP), the real estate arm of Housing & Development Bank, has signed a cooperation agreement with EPower to manage, operate, and maintain electricity and water networks across several of its residential developments.

The agreement aims to ensure the efficient operation of utility infrastructure and enhance service continuity across HDP’s projects.

Under the agreement, EPower will be responsible for the operation and maintenance of medium- and low-voltage electricity distribution networks, in addition to managing water supply services. The company will contract directly with residents, install and operate electricity and water meters, issue monthly consumption bills, and collect payments in accordance with tariffs set by the Egyptian Electric Utility and Consumer Protection Regulatory Agency and the Egyptian Water and Wastewater Regulatory Agency.

The scope of work also includes conducting routine and corrective maintenance, supplying spare parts, and overseeing all operational phases in line with applicable safety and quality standards, with the objective of ensuring uninterrupted service.

Amgad Hassanein, Vice Chairperson of HDP, said the company’s strategy is based on partnering with specialized service providers to support the efficient operation of its developments. He emphasized that integrated utility management is essential to meeting residents’ daily needs and ensuring the long-term sustainability of real estate projects.

Ahmed Nada, CEO and Managing Director of EPower, said the company continues to expand its presence across residential and mixed-use developments in Egypt, currently serving more than 45 developers and approximately 35,000 customers. He added that the partnership with HDP reflects EPower’s commitment to enhancing service quality and operational efficiency.

The agreement covers seven HDP developments, including Club Hills, Westview, and Terrace in West Cairo; Tadla, Square One Exclusive Residences, and The Gray in East Cairo; and The Island project at Marina 5 on the North Coast. EPower will also provide technical and after-sales support across all covered projects.
